PEOPLE v. LESLIE


210 A.D.2d 80 (1994)

620 N.Y.S.2d 30

The People of the State of New York, Respondent, v. Anthony Leslie, Appellant

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, First Department.

December 13, 1994


Defendant was convicted after trial of assaulting the complainant at a flea market with a wooden board which had a nail in it. While the complainant and another witness testified the attack was without provocation, defendant testified that complainant had hit him in the back with a crowbar after an altercation over the sale of a table.
